What type of contract is an option to buy contract?

An option to buy contract is an agreement between two parties where an investor or tenant pays a fee in exchange for the rights to purchase property at some point in the future. You can have a straight option to buy a contract, which is a unilateral contract that only binds the seller to its terms.

Is an option contract revocable?

A promise to keep an offer open that is paid for. With an option contact, the offeror is not permitted to revoke the offer because with the payment, he is bargaining away his right to revoke the offer.

Is an option contract a bilateral contract?

When created, an option contract is a unilateral contract. But when the buyer exercises the option, it becomes a bilateral contract. The option is assignable to another party unless the contract forbids it.

Is option to purchase a binding contract?

The Offer to Purchase is not usually considered the binding legal agreement, whereas the Option to Purchase is. Also, note that the Option to Purchase is drafted by the seller’s lawyer, whereas the Offer to Purchase is from the buyer to the seller (it’s often drafted by the buyer’s agent).

    What’s one of the required elements of a valid option contract?

    An option contract has two elements: 1) the underlying contract which is not binding until accepted; and 2) the agreement to hold open to the optionee the opportunity to accept. In addition, an option contract requires consideration.

    Why must an option be recorded?

    Recording notice of an option gives constructive notice of the option to lenders and potential Buyers, but will not make an otherwise defective option enforceable. The Buyer also needs to be sure to satisfy the requirements of an enforceable option. An option to purchase is a contract.

    What are the two types of options?

    There are two types of options: calls and puts. Call options allow the option holder to purchase an asset at a specified price before or at a particular time. Put options are opposites of calls in that they allow the holder to sell an asset at a specified price before or at a particular time.

    What is a call option contract?

    What are call options? A call option is a contract between a buyer and a seller to purchase a certain stock at a certain price up until a defined expiration date. The buyer of a call has the right, not the obligation, to exercise the call and purchase the stocks.
